Optimization of the energy characteristics of an oxygen–iodine laser

R. M. Gizatullin, V. A. Katulin, S. G. Kuznetsov, A. Yu. Kurov, V. V. Mukhin, V. D. Nikolaev, A. L. Petrov, V. M. Pichkasov, M. I. Svistun


Abstract: An analysis is made of the quenching of singlet oxygen in the process of its transport from a chemical reactor to a resonator in a chemical oxygen–iodine laser. It is shown that for a given construction of the laser there is an optimal oxygen pressure at which the maximum energy can be deposited in the active medium. Simple expressions are derived for estimating the ultimate energy characteristics of such a chemical laser.
